PSEG Long Island and Suffolk County join forces for the popular Energy-Saving Trees giveaway

In honor of Earth Day 2024, PSEG Long Island and Suffolk County, in partnership with the PSEG Foundation and the Arbor Day Foundation, will provide more than 250 customers in Suffolk County with a free tree through the Energy-Saving Trees program. The program showcases how planting the right trees in the right location can reduce utility bills and promote ongoing system reliability.

“Earth Day is a chance for all of us to stand up and do our part to help build a greener, more equitable future,” said David Lyons, PSEG Long Island’s interim president and COO. “Strategically planting trees helps save up to 20% on summer energy bills once the trees are fully grown, while also improving air quality and reducing storm water runoff for all residents across Long Island and the Rockaways.”

The free energy-saving trees can be reserved at www.arborday.org/pseglongisland starting Monday, April 15, until all trees are claimed. The reserved trees will then be available for pick-up on Friday, April 19, at the H. Lee Dennison Building in Hauppauge, from 8 a.m.-1 p.m. All reserved trees will be held until noon, when they will become available on a first come, first served basis.

“We continue to identify and find every opportunity to make Suffolk County environmentally sustainable, and planting just one tree can make a difference,” said Suffolk County Executive Ed Romaine. “We encourage all of our residents to take part in the PSEG Long Island Energy Saving Trees program and work collaboratively to embrace clean energy and improve our region’s air quality. Together we will continue to raise awareness and make a difference.”

“Trees add beauty to neighborhoods, help reduce energy consumption, filter pollutants that improve the overall health and wellbeing of our communities, provide places of respite, along with many other benefits. Of course, we also always recommend planting the right type of tree in the right place,” said Calvin Ledford, president of the PSEG Foundation. “The PSEG Foundation is proud to support the Energy-Saving Trees program, which will help provide more than 200 trees for Suffolk County residents. We are excited that our employees have this and many opportunities to provide energy efficiency information and help create a more sustainable ecosystem across Long Island and the Rockaways.”

The Energy-Saving Trees online tool helps customers estimate the annual energy savings that will result from planting trees in the most strategic location near their homes or businesses. All customers that participate will receive one tree and are expected to care for and plant them in the location provided by the online tool, taking into account utility wires and obstructions. The types of trees offered include the following: gray birch, eastern white pine, flowering dogwood and scarlet oak.

Port Jeff Branch LIRR riders still waiting for basic amenities at Grand Central Madison

It has been 14 months since the Long Island Rail Road began full-time East Side Access service to the $11.6 billion Grand Central Madison terminal in the Midtown East neighborhood of Manhattan, with the prospect of benefits for Port Jefferson Branch riders. So it is disappointing that MTA Chairman Janno Lieber just announced the release of a request for proposals for a master developer to manage and operate all 32 vacant storefronts at GCM. Responses are due by June with a contract award in summer 2024. MTA anticipates that all 32 storefronts should be open for business by 2026.

In the meantime, only one storefront will be occupied later this year. This is a sad commentary on MTA Chairman Janno Lieber, MTA Office of Capital Construction and MTA Real Estate in management of the LIRR ESA GCM project. The original completion date was 2011. Full-time service began in February 2023. MTA Real Estate had years to find tenants for the vacant storefronts. They should have completed the process to hire a master developer to manage the storefronts years ago. This would have given the master developer plenty of time to find tenants for the vacant storefronts and give tenants adequate time to coordinate the opening of their stores.

Waiting three years until 2026 before all 32 storefronts are open for business is a failure. Given the physical layout, it is also not credible to believe that you can replicate the Metro-North Grand Central Madison Dining Concourse. There is no central location for significant seating. MTA clearly dropped the ball for planning retail openings. It also represents a loss of three years’ worth of tenant revenue. Riders will continue looking at the artwork covering up the vacant storefronts. Commuters and taxpayers have to also ask when will the other vacant storefronts at NYC Transit, Long Island and Metro-North Railroad stations be leased. Why was MTA Real Estate unable to lease all vacant assets in a timely manner? It would have generated badly-needed revenue and provided riders with the basic amenities they are still looking for.

For decades, Castle Connolly has been conducting a peer-review survey to select the region’s top doctors based on the theory that medical professionals are best qualified to assess the qualifications of other practitioners. Licensed physicians vote online for those doctors they consider outstanding. A Castle Connolly doctor-led research team then counts the nominations and vets the nominee pool with the aid of  several screens, including confirming board certifications and investigating disciplinary histories. Most times, a harmless looking “1-3” in the scorebook isn’t the most impactful play in a baseball game.

But with the Northport Tigers clinging to a skinny, one-run lead in the bottom of the 5th inning against Smithtown East on Thursday night, that 1-3 became a lucky 13.

Relief pitcher Vincent Staub entered the game in a bit of a mess. Smithtown East had already scored two runs in the frame and had cut a 5-1 Tiger lead to 5-3. Staub allowed an RBI single to short-stop Evan Schickler that brought the Bulls to within one.

After Schickler stole second base, the tying and go-ahead runs were on second and third.

East third-baseman Ryan Diffley hit a sharp one-hopper back to Staub, who managed to deflect the ball towards the first base foul line. Staub scampered off the mound and flipped the ball to Tiger first-baseman Dylan Sofarelli just in time to beat Diffley to the bag.

Northport retained its lead and Staub would finish the game, retiring the side in order in the sixth and seventh for a 5-4 win.

Liam Ryan, who pitched a courageous 4 ⅔ innings, recorded his second win of the year. He and Staub combined to pitch a no-hitter against Centereach in the season opener and are proving to be quite a one-two punch for Sean Lynch’s Tigers who improved to 3-1 with this win.

Northport jumped out to 4-0 lead with two in the first and a loud two-RBI double in the third off the bat of second-baseman Thomas Hardick. Sofarelli drew a bases-loaded walk in the fourth to make it 5-1, but Northport had the bases loaded with nobody out after that, but did not plate anybody else.

Ryan, who is making his debut in the starting rotation this year, was effective through his 4 2/3, retiring the side in order in the fourth. But he tired in the fifth, setting up Staub’s houdini act to rescue him and the Tigers. The duo combined to strike out six Bulls.

The two teams moved west on Friday night and East got a measure of revenge with a 7-0 win. Northport is 3-2 on the year and Smithtown East 3-1. The Tigers will face North Babylon next week for three games and East will play Centereach.

Recent setbacks in East Beach bluff stabilization project have officials and residents on edge 

By Lynn Hallarman

East Beach is a village-owned strip of sandy shoreline situated between the northern front of the Long Island Sound and the base or toe of a steeply set bluff, roughly 100 feet high.

A jetty opens into Mount Sinai Harbor eastward of the bluff. To the west, the shore stretches past a series of private properties, then past the village of Belle Terre, and finally curves inward, reconfiguring as Port Jefferson Harbor. 

For decades, the village-owned Port Jefferson Country Club, perched near the crest of the bluff, was invisible to beachgoers below, shielded by a thick tangle of greenery clinging to the bluff’s north front. 

But in recent years, a series of intense rainstorms, combined with sea rise and pressures from human-made alterations in the landscape above the bluff, have set in motion deforestation and scouring, denuding the bluff of vegetation and accelerating erosion in the direction of the country club’s foundation. The club has become precariously close to the bluff’s edge. Without a plan, there was no doubt it would slide down the bluff onto the shoreline below within a few years. 

To make matters worse, the bluff stabilization project, whose aim is to stabilize the position of the club, has been beset with complications in the wake of a series of recent storms unraveling costly work completed just last summer as part of Phase I of the project.

As communities across Long Island are confronting relentless coastal erosion, TBR News Media focuses on the obstacles facing the bluff stabilization project at East Beach, exploring the complexities, costs and alternative solutions to rescuing the country club.

The big picture

Bluffs change naturally over time, feeding sand to the beach and replenishing the shoreline. They respond to the force of winds, waves and tides, creating new states of equilibrium with the beach below and the landscapes above. The Long Island shoreline has been reshaping for thousands of years, sometimes imperceptibly and sometimes in dramatic fits of landslip that is, chunks of shoreline abruptly falling into the sea. 

East Beach and its bluff are inseparable from the adjacent coastline they move as the coastline moves. When humans make changes in the shorelines by adding bulkheads, jetties and other rigid structures, the effects resonate laterally, affecting the movement of sand and ocean from beach to beach along the shoreline. 

“Port Jefferson’s experience with bluff restoration is a microcosm of what has been happening all over Long Island,” said Chuck Hamilton, a marine biologist and former regional natural resource supervisor for the state Department of Environmental Conservation for some 33 years.

“For a long time, farmers on Long Island had their farms right on top of the bluff, and shoreline erosion happened naturally,” he said. But now those same areas are being subdivided and developed, adding weight and impermeable surfaces abutting the shoreline. “And guess what? Now we need to stabilize.”

The project

When Port Jefferson’s mayor, Lauren Sheprow, took office in July 2023, the bluff stabilization project was already in motion. Sheprow, a former public relations professional, had campaigned on a platform of two core values: financial transparency and safeguarding of village assets. However, the realities of rescuing the country club purchased in 1978 when her father, Harold Sheprow, was village mayor while keeping project costs under control have proven to be complex and demanding. 

Most of Phase I of the project happened before the current mayor took office. This work included the installation of a 454-foot rigid wall at the base, terracing and native grass plantings on the bluff face. With Phase II now under her purview, Sheprow believes it is her responsibility to see the project to completion: the installation of a wall system along the bluff’s crest, directly seaward of the imperiled country club. 

“I swore to protect and preserve the property owned by the Village of Port Jefferson, and therefore the residents. Preserving and protecting is not ignoring an erosion issue,” the mayor said.

Phase I, costing approximately $5 million, relied on local taxpayer dollars financed through a bond repayable over time. Phase II, estimated at $4.8 million, will be financed mostly by federal taxpayer dollars by a FEMA grant of $3.75 million.  

Financing the endeavor has been rife with holdups and stymied by a six-year-long permitting process. It has been almost a year since Phase I was completed. Final signoffs related to the FEMA funding for Phase II are still pending, preventing the village from seeking bids for construction of the upper wall. However, the village treasurer, Stephen Gaffga, said he hopes to see the signoffs come through this month. 

By many accounts, questions about the project’s funding have rankled residents for years. The prevailing sentiment is that the village pushed through a $10 million bond for the stabilization project (phases I and II combined) without a community vote through a bond resolution. 

“When I am asked about my position about the bluff restoration, I never saw the arguments on all sides of the project flushed out,” said Ana Hozyainova, president of Port Jefferson Civic Association. “Village officials took the position from the beginning that the building must be saved, no matter what. That imperative has limited the discussions about options.”

Complications

The uncertainty surrounding the cost and timing of needed repairs because of winter storm damage to the bluff faces further complications in Phase II. “Negotiations are ongoing” between the village and the contractor about who is responsible for absorbing these additional expenses, Gaffga said. 

Drainage issues at the bluff’s crest are also hampering progress, and likely contributed to the recent collapse of the newly-installed terracing along the western part of the bluff, below the tennis courts. “There are huge puddles sitting at the crest, after heavy [recent] rainstorms,” Sheprow said. The strategy and cost related to addressing the drainage issues have not yet been determined, she added. 

Although the project was divided into two phases because of funding constraints, “its ultimate success,” according to Laura Schwanof, senior ecologist at GEI Consultants of Huntington Station, “hinges on both walls working together to curtail erosion and prevent the club slipping down the slope.” 

GEI has been involved with village erosion mitigation projects since 2009. The two-wall system for the bluff stabilization was their design. “The problem with this project is protection number two the upper wall has not been installed,” Schwanof said. When asked how long the wall system might hold up, she couldn’t say. 

“What does happen, and has been seen across the Northeast, is that as we get more frequent storms, higher wave energy, higher rainfall events, rigid wall structures may work in the short term. But if you look 50 years down the road, they may not be as effective,” she said. 

“Hard erosion protection structures such as revetments or bulkheads can be costly, only partially effective over time and may even deflect wave energy onto adjacent properties.” Jeff Wernick, a DEC representative, wrote in an email. The DEC, he said, permitted the East Beach project based solely on “the immediate threat to significant infrastructure.”

Retreat?

 When Steve Englebright, 5th District county legislator (D-Setauket) and geologist, was asked about the stabilization project, he started with a lesson about glacial formations dating back 17,000 years. Englebright scrutinized photographs of the bluff during an interview with TBR News conducted after the recent storms. 

“When the bluff, which is partially made of clay, is overweighted it behaves like squeezed toothpaste,” he said. “You can see toothpaste-like extrusions on the beach.”

Missing from the conversation, according to Englebright, is a reckoning of what is happening along the entire Long Island coast. “People don’t understand the overall dynamics,” he said. “That’s why I’m trying to give you the big picture that the entire North Shore is unstable.”

“Trying to defend a single property is human folly,” he added. “You can buy some time, but how much are we paying? I don’t believe it’s realistic because you can’t stop the overall dynamic. The village should celebrate the fact that they have the ability to retreat and use that ability. Right? The bind is if you don’t have land, but they have the land. Strategically retreat, rebuild the building.”

Stan Loucks, a village trustee and a former country club liaison, was asked to put together a retreat plan by former Mayor Margot Garant confirmed by her to TBR News. “I did a plan A proceed with the restoration project or plan B, retreat about three years ago,” Loucks said. “I got prices for the demolition of the country club, moving the tennis courts and an architectural rendering of a new club further inland.” 

“The drawings had a huge deck on this side overlooking the Sound, and the huge deck on this side overlooking the golf course. I would have loved to take that plan to the end,” he added. 

Loucks’s retreat plan was never vetted publicly. Sheprow told TBR she never saw a retreat plan. 

Loucks remembers when tennis court No. 5 went in a landslide a few years ago. “It was massive and happened overnight,” he said. “And the slide took the gazebo, too.”

By Daniel Dunaief

A traffic light turns green and a driver can make a left turn. Similarly, plants on one path can change direction when they receive a particular signal. In the case of the sorghum plant, the original direction involves growth. A series of signals, however, sends it on a different trajectory, enabling the plant to flower and reproduce, halting the growth cycle.

Brookhaven Lab biologist Meng Xie and postdoctoral fellow Dimiru Tadesse in the lab. Photo by Kevin Coughlin/ BNL

Understanding and altering this process could allow the plant to grow for a longer period of time. Additional growth increases the biomass of this important energy crop, making each of these hearty plants, which can survive in semiarid regions and can tolerate relatively high temperatures, more productive when they are converted into biomass in the form of ethanol, which is added to gasoline.

Recently, Brookhaven National Laboratory biologist Meng Xie teamed up with Million Tadege, Professor in the Department of Plant and Soil Science at Oklahoma State University, among others, to find genes and the mechanism that controls flowering in sorghum.

Plants that produce more biomass have a more developed root system, which can sequester more carbon and store it in the soil.

The researchers worked with a gene identified in other studies called SbGhd7 that extends the growth period when it is overexpressed.

Validating the importance of that gene, Xie and his colleagues were able to produce about three times the biomass of a sorghum plant compared to a control that flowered earlier and produced grain.

The plants they grew didn’t reach the upper limit of size and, so far, the risk of extensive growth  that might threaten the survival of the plant is unknown.

Researchers at Oklahoma State University conducted the genetic work, while Xie led the molecular mechanistic studies at BNL.

At OSU, the researchers used a transgenic sorghum plant to over express the flowering-control gene, which increased the protein it produced. These plants didn’t flower at all.

“This was a dramatic difference from what happens in rice plants when they overexpress their version of this same gene,” Xie explained in a statement. “In rice, overexpression of this gene delays flowering for eight to 20 days — not forever!”

In addition to examining the effect of changing the concentration of the protein produced, Xie also explored the way this protein recognized and bound to promoters of its targets to repress target expression.

Xie did “a lot of molecular studies to understand the underlying mechanism, which was pretty hard to perform in sorghum previously,” he said.

Xie worked with protoplasts, which are plant cells whose outer wall has been removed. He inserted a so-called plasmid, which is a small piece of DNA, into their growth medium, which the plants added to their DNA.

The cells can survive in a special incubation/ growth medium, enabling the protoplasts to incorporate the plasmid.

Sorghum plant. Photo by Kevin Coughlin/ BNL

Xie attached a small protein to the gene so they could monitor the way it interacted in the plant. They also added antibodies that bound to this protein, which allowed them to cut out and observe the entire antibody-protein DNA complex to determine which genes were involved in this critical growth versus flowering signaling pathway.

The flowering repressor gene bound to numerous targets. 

Xie and his BNL colleagues found the regulator protein’s binding site, which is a short DNA sequence within the promoter for each target gene.

Conventional wisdom in the scientific community suggested this regulator protein would affect one activator gene. Through his molecular mechanistic studies, Xie uncovered the interaction with several genes.

“In our model, we found that [the signaling] is much more complicated,” he said. The plant looks like it can “bypass each [gene] to affect flowering.”

Regulation appears to have crosstalk and feedback loops, he explained.

The process of coaxing these plants to continue to grow provides a one-way genetic street, which prevents the plant from developing flowers and reproducing.

These altered plants would prevent any cross contamination with flowering plants, which would help scientists and, potentially down the road, farmers meet regulatory requirements to farm this source of biomass.

Ongoing efforts

The targets he found, which recognize the short sequence of DNA, also appears in many other flowering genes.

Xie said the group’s hypothesis is that this regulator in the form of this short sequence of DNA also may affect flowering genes in other plants, such as maize and rice.

Xie is continuing to work with researchers at OSU to study the function of the numerous targets in the flowering and growth processes. 

He hopes to develop easy ways to control flowering which might include spraying a chemical that blocks flowering and removing it to reactive reproduction. This system would be helpful in controlling cross contamination. He also would like to understand how environmental conditions affect sorghum, which is work he’s doing in the lab. Down the road, he might also use the gene editing tool CRISPR to induce expression at certain times.

Honing the technique to pursue this research took about four years to develop, while Xie and his students spent about a year searching for the molecular mechanisms involved.
